Roger H. Morris, CLU®, ChFC®, joined New York Life in 1980 after 18 years as a high school teacher and administrator. Although Roger has worked for more than 30 years with Small Business owners to address their personal and business needs in the areas of Executive Benefits, Retirement, and Financial Planning, his current focus is Transition Planning.
Roger earned his undergraduate degree at Wayne State College in Nebraska. He completed his Masters at Cal State University at Fullerton and pursued his postgraduate study at the University of Southern California. Roger has served as President of NAIFA, Orange County and has been an active member of the Orange County Estate Planning Council and Planned Giving Roundtable. Roger has multiple qualifications as Agent of the Year for the South Coast GO and is a recipient of the Agent of the Year Award by the South Coast GAMA. Roger served on the Planned Gift Development Committee of the Children’s Hospital of Orange County and the Board of Directors for Consumer Credit Counseling Services of Orange County. He has been awarded the Outstanding Volunteer of the Year Award by the Volunteer Center of Orange County. Roger’s personal interests are family, golf, tennis and travel. Jasmita "Jessie" Patel, CLU®, LUTCF, has been an agent with New York Life since 2006 and R H Morris Group since 2008.
Jessie grew up in Southern California and has clients all over the United States. Jessie earned a Bachelor of Arts Degree with emphasis in Marketing and Management from Chapman University in Orange, California. Jessie enjoys international travel and spending time with family and friends. Qualifications:

Marc's top priority is quality time with family and friends. Marty is a retired New York Life agent and is currently an Associate Financial Advisor with R H Morris Insurance and Financial Services.
Marty has worked with owners of closely held businesses for more than twelve years in the areas of employee benefits, retirement, and personal planning. Her approach has emphasized a team effort with other professional advisors in building effective strategies for her clients. Marty has served on various community and professional Board of Directors. During her tenure as chairman of the CHOC Padrinos board she facilitated the funding of an endowed gift to the NICU. She has served on the Orange County board of the National Association of Insurance and Financial Advisors and is a member of the Society of Financial Service Professionals. She currently volunteers on Vanguard University’s Business Council, mentoring MBA students and developing the Speakers Series. Marty has recently begun working with Passkeys Founder, Russ Williams, in the development of the Ethical Edge Leadership Forum, shaping a culture of integrity and character in personal and professional lives. She earned her undergraduate degree from Arizona State University, where she graduated summa cum laude. Her passions include tennis, golf, traveling and spending time with her family and friends.
